大食物观下食物承载力结构性耦合、时空演化与驱动因素研究
THE STRUCTURAL COUPLING,TEMPORAL AND SPATIAL EVOLUTION AND DRIVING FACTORS OF FOOD CARRYING CAPACITY UNDER THE VIEW OF BIG FOOD
摘要
Abstract
In order to objectively evaluate the structural coupling state of food carrying capacity and build an analysis framework of the structural coupling index system of food carrying capacity based on nutrients such as energy,fat and protein is constructed,providing scientific basis for China to achieve food security.Using the panel data of 329 prefecture level cities in China from 2000 to 2020,the distribution characteristics,temporal and spatial evolution and driving factors of the structural coupling index of food carrying capacity under the macro food view were analyzed by using global Moran's I,Moran scatter diagram,Lisa agglomeration diagram and spatial Dubin model.The study found that:(1)The structural coupling index of food carrying capacity in prefecture level cities in China showed an overall upward trend,but the growth rate slowed down significantly,and there were regional differences.The structural coupling index of food carrying capacity in Central China and Northeast China was higher,while that in East China,South China,northwest and southwest China was lower,and North China was at the average level in China.(2)The structural coupling index of food carrying capacity of prefecture level cities in China showed positive spatial correlation and two pole agglomeration,and the phenomenon of high-value agglomeration was more obvious.HH concentrated in Northeast,North and central China;LL area was distributed in southwest,northwest and Yangtze River Delta.The spatial imbalance was significant,and the overall pattern was stable but partially dynamically adjusted,highlighting the characteristics of"high in the north and low in the south,and low-lying core urban agglomeration".(3)Grain production,meat production,proportion of labor population,urbanization rate and grain planting area promoted the increase of the structural coupling index of food carrying capacity,while the resident population inhibited the growth of the structural coupling index of food carrying capacity.In summary,the spatial-temporal characteristics of the structural coupling index of food carrying capacity in prefecture level cities in China are obvious.In order to ensure national food security,it is proposed to improve agricultural infrastructure,speed up the construction of high standard farmland,implement differentiated food carrying capacity policy,and control urban area while promote regional coordinated development.关键词
